Juniper Appoints Shaygan Kheradpir CEO

Juniper Networks has appointed Shaygan Kheradpir as its chief executive officer, effective January 1, 2014. Mr. Kheradpir succeeds Kevin Johnson, who in July announced his plan to retire as CEO, and will remain as a member of the board.

Mr. Kheradpir joins Juniper Networks from Barclays where he served as the chief operations and technology officer, and as a member of its executive committee. Prior to joining Barclays, he was executive vice president and chief information and technology officer at Verizon Communications, and part of the management team when Verizon was created.

Mr. Kheradpir holds a bachelor’s, master’s, and Ph.D. in electrical engineering from Cornell University.
